We hope that yours is everything you have been dreaming of. Your local union has paid your first years dues in the General Teamsters Retirees Club (GTRC). The club is made up of the retirees and spouses of locals 38, 174, 117, and 763. Annual dues are 10 dollars.
Your GTRC hosts a luncheon the second Wednesday of each month. One exception is August, when we sponsor a golf tournament in lieu of a lunch. The golf tourney is essentially a fund raiser for our college scholarship program to aid the children and grandchildren of Teamster active and retired members.
Our club also has a yearly Thanksgiving and Christmas gift-card plan wherein we give needy Teamster families gift cards redeemable at local supermarkets. Our luncheons are accompanied by a short business meeting, a topical guest speaker (or speakers), prizes and great entertainment at all times.
Your GTRC has an E-board of 7 volunteers. We meet once a month to discuss finances and club business. So come on and join us for lunch when you can. You may meet some old friends, or make some new ones. Most of the information you need will be in our monthly newsletter sent to your residence.
